Death's Door

Death is a time where people will never breathe We can’t talk or walk and even squawk about our lives that we lead What do you suppose is behind deaths door? I’m just wondering, because eventually is going to come to us all Should we be scare? Or fight for it, not to happen? Or just let it be? Has anyone thought about Death, like me? Death has come for two people I had a chance to know on, 02/02/12; however, this was a week ago. Do you think they knew? Some people may not know, when it’s time for them to go, therefore; we should ask JESUS CHIRST to come into our lives and be prepared for that day So, when death wants to knock on our door We can open it up and say I’m ready, let’s go, and see that place called Heaven’s Tour
